Don't make the mistake of thinking St. John's is a good team. They aren't. They win by getting teams to play a game of street ball instead of executing their offense or defense. MU let them dictate the game from beginning to end last time. Markus and Haanif got their lunches eaten as they combined for 11 of the team's 17 turnovers. I don't think that happens again. If I'm Wojo, I'm telling the team to commit to the offensive plan, make the extra pass and take the open shot when you have it. I tell Luke that Yakwe and Owens go for the block every time and bite on every shot fake. If he fakes before he makes his move he will be able to go up and get the foul or spin right around them for an easy bucket. On defense, this is the one game where I'd advocate for zone. Use an aggressive 2-3 and make them a jumpshooting team. They simply don't have the discipline to beat a zone and will take a lot of bad shots and drive into traffic.

I'm feeling a double digit win tonight. If Marquette executes, it will be a blowout. If they play like they did in MSG, they will lose, but not by much. SJU is an entirely different beast on the road.
